Will the Furrion Chill Cube Remotes Interfere w/ Each Other?

Question:
I am thinking about buying two Furion RV roof air conditioners for my 30 foot RV. They both have handheld remote control units. Will they interfere with each other? Will they cross-talk?
asked by: Thomas T
Expert Reply:
Hey Tom. The remote included with the Furrion Chill Cube item # FR99TD uses an IR signal to communicate so whatever AC you point the remote at will be controlled by that remote. So long as you don't use both remotes at the same time or point one at the AC you're not trying to adjust you won't have an issue.
The Furrion Chill Cube item # FR99TD is a 18,000 Btu system that works with ducted set ups. It includes the AC unit, air distribution box, and the remote control.
If you have a ductless setup you'll want the Furrion Chill Cube RV item # FR59TD, which has the same features and parts.
